Once upon a time, there was a brand new company that created play parks. They decided to set up their first play park in a city full of many other play parks. Because of all the competition, they realized they would need an interesting and novel format that would attract kids from all across the city. The company hired all kinds of intelligent people to being the creation of the park. When it was finally opened, children flocked from all over town to visit the park. No entrance fee was required- however, one could only play at the park for a few hours before a small payment was required. The play park wasn't made of the highest quality material, and it didn't have the aesthetic flare of other parks, but its intriguing design was one of a kind. The monkey bars were just the right height and length, there were exactly the right number of swings, and the large curvy slide was extremely entertaining. From day one, the company drew in an unprecedented amount of revenue, and soon hundreds of kids visited the park every day. Of course, there were still a few problems with the park- the equipment would break, and kids would get hurt every now and then. But the intelligent design of the park kept it going. Eventually, the park owners decided that they needed to expand. They acquired the plots of land next to the current park, and set up new equipment. This was all well and good, but many of the park's visitors felt that the new expansion lacked the creative vision of the original. Nevertheless, the park continued to gain popularity. Children of all ages and types would spend hours playing in the park. The park owners decided they needed to introduce one major update to the park. They needed to stun everyone, or the park's popularity bubble might crash. Looking around at the other huge, beautiful parks, the owners decided they would re-make the entire park, with the highest quality material. The park employees told the park visitors of the upcoming update, and everyone was excited. However, the builders who would rebuild the park took a very long time. Month after month passed after the original deadline, and the park owners decided that they needed to change the plan. Unfortunately, they failed to appreciate the true reason why the children liked the park: It's originality. The park owners planned to tear down the old park, and set up an entirely new park with a similar but different design. And that they did. When the new park was introduced, some children were elated, and some were horrified. Many children flocked to the new park at the beginning, if anything just to gawk at the changes. The park owners were very enthusiastic about this popularity. However, the park's attention began to wane. Overall, the children were not impressed with the changes to the park, and they began to play elsewhere. The park was still very popular, and this popularity was still increasing. The children that liked the park invited their friends, and a chain reaction began. But, the park's revenue definitely wasn't increasing. The park was much bigger and with many more employees than they began with, and they realized that an economic emergency might be looming in the future. Thus, the park owners increased the fees and decreased the amount of time one could play in the park without paying. Less children entered the park because of this, but the revenue was definitely increased. The park makers still felt like they needed to stun the children in order to bring back the glory days. They planned the introduction of an entirely new park, just across the road. Perhaps if they created a brand new park separate from the original, popularity would increase. They planned for this park to be introduced in a year's time. Meanwhile, they shuffled through more and more employees. At some point, the park makers stopped caring about the quality of the old park. After all, the old park wouldn't matter all that much when the new park was introduced. The only thing the park owners really cared about was their profit. What they didn't realize was that the children were more perceptive than at first glance. They realized the greed and plots of the park makers, and they complained. The employees laughed it off, they were only children. The park makers continued to increase the fees required to play at the park. A year or so passed, and the deadline had been reached. Still, the new park was not opened. The park owners were once again running low on money, so they decided to make a few features of the park only accessible by paying customers. A huge slide in the middle of the park was only available to those with a special ticked that costed money. The children hated this new update, and dozens stopped playing in the park altogether. The park owners continued to tell the children that all the problems would be solved in the new park. However, they refused to say if the new park would be as free as the first one. In fact, they refused to say almost anything about the new park. More and more children dropped out, and the fees rose sky high. The park makers blamed this incident on the changing demographic of the city. The children who had initially played at the park were now older and no longer wished to play at parks, and that is why less people visited the parks. This was partially true, but not entirely. Finally, almost two years late, the new park was created. A massive wall was set up around it, and the park makers only let a select handful of "testers" enter the park for the first time. Strangely, these "testers" appeared to be completely random people- the only common factor is that almost none of them had experience in the first park. This was purposeful. The developers wanted an entirely new and unbiased player base to enter the new park. They would try to keep the old park open, and keep the original group of kids in this old park. They did not want the old, committed players to "test" the new park, because they were worried they would lose customers from the old park, and thus lose revenue. They didn't tell any of the customers- they were just kids, of course. In fact, the company split itself into two pieces- the old park, and the new park. The employees would be completely separate from one another. This divide in communication was disastrous. No one knew what was going on, and there was absolutely no organization. Finally, the new park was opened to the public. It was good in the beginning, but soon everything dissolved into chaos. The park management was completely naive. None of their goals were accomplished in the end, and eventually almost all employees were laid off. For the next three or four years, the park continued to run. But the material was old, and the park was extremely unpopular. Eventually, the park declared bankruptcy. The park was torn down and the parts sold as scrap metal. The land was confiscated and eventually sold to a neighboring apartment complex. The park was over. Oh, and this park was called "Tanky". The end.

Advantages of Low-Rankedness
RIPcrystalboxes replied to RIPcrystalboxes in Advantages of Low-Rankedness Archive
Greetings! This is the amazingly confusing, bewildering, enigmatic, paradoxical, nonsensical, and ingenious RIP crystal boxes. I am here to discuss the advantages and disadvantages of being low ranking. 1. Everything is cheaper. You start out with 500 crystals. You get 200 crystals for joining a battle, and 200 crystals for your first purchase. This adds up to 700 free crystals. This may not sound like a lot, but I will explain how it is. An XP combo (railgun/hornet) costs 600 crystals, and you can get it at rank gefreiter, for free and with 100 crystals to spare... An M0 railgun costs 250 crystals. An M3 railgun costs 218, 300 crystals. An M0 Hornet costs 350 crystals, and an M3 Hornet costs 158 300. An M3 XP combo costs 376,600 crystals. Obviously, you earn a lot more crystals in high ranking battles because the battle fund is higher. And also, M3 Railgun and Hornet have better performance than the M0 counterparts, (loading, speed, not to mention looks) but they are also fighting other M3 combos with much higher performances. So, it is relative. Also, some interesting math: 600 = 37600 /6 /6 100 = 62 766 *7 *7 700 = 439 366 /700 /700 1 = 627 So, the free crystals you get at Recruit, are equivalent to 439 366 crystals at M3. And every 'M0 crystal' equals 627 M3 crystals. That is quite a lot. With these 700 free crystals, you can buy any combo available at Gefreiter, and a lot of M0 combos. Greetings, this is the amazingly confusing, bewildering, enigmatic, paradoxical, nonsensical, and ingenious RIPcrystalboxes. Anyways, there have been a lot of changes to the game lately, and there are still many more to come. I want to explain somethings that I believe. This game is so diverse. There is the big divide between the Russian and English players. Then, among the english players, there are the bad players and the good players. The bad players only want to drive around and blow people up. They don't care about winning or about D/L. They often times don't seem to think things all the way through (hence all the terrible threads in Ideas and Suggestions) The good players play a battle to the end, trying to win it at all cost. They think a lot. They are the people who right interesting topic and posts on the forum. They are usually the best in a battle, and many other things. Then there are the buyers, the people who think this game is a dating site, and the druggers. All these categories have different opinions on how the game should work. For instance, one of the biggest changes talked about was the removal of crystal boxes. The bad players probably hate this. Now, instead of driving around randomly picking up crystal boxes, they have to actually try to help their team. The good players probably earn a lot more crystals now, but many regret seeing a very important part of the game go extinct. This update was probably good for tanki online as a whole. It makes people actually have to help their team, and encourages players to get good. Long before the removal of crystals, was the rebalance. A lot of people I know hated this update. Every single one of my real life friends who played the game left during this update. A lot of people hated that they lost their M2 or M3 turrets and hulls. This update got rid of the two 'tiers', and in my opinion made four tiers: M0, M1, M2, M3. I didn't like this rebalance particularly, but I was too low ranking to care very much. This update was probably better for tankionline as a whole, because it added a new layer of complexity. Back before the rebalance, you never saw Marshalls driving M3 Smoky, Firebird, or practically any of the tier one turrets. But now, you will see every single M3 turret being used my Generalissimos. The addition of a new turret (Hammer) was probably a good idea. It will make more inactive players, especially high ranking ones, play the game a lot more to try out and play the new turret, and turrets. It will also change the gameplay of tanki online, for better or worse. I can't say yet, and am not here to give my opinion on the new turret. No matter what tanki online does, there will always be a lot of players not happy, because there are so many different views on tanki online. Probably a lot of players just wish they could get tons of crystals and rank really quickly. I think that the Russians have a much different world view for the game, but I couldn't say for sure. Tankionline is more based on skill than strategy. There is a difference between the two. For example, Basketball is a very strategic game, but it is also very skill based. It takes a lot of skill to throw a ball into a tiny hoop ten feet in the air from long distances. But soccer, has some skill but it is mostly strategic. There is a much bigger field, and more players. Almost anyone can kick a ball into a goal, but a lot of people couldn't make a basket too easily. World of tanks is more strategic than this game, but less skill based. Anyone can click on an enemy tank with their mouse. Less people can aim a railgun halfway across the map to kill an enemy. In world of tanks, you don't get to re spawn. This adds a ton to the strategy. In tankionline, you can die and re spawn as often as you like. A lot of people wish tanki online was more strategic, or more skillful. I don't really have an opinion A lot of people suspect hidden motive behind the developer's actions. In some of my previous articles, I mention some of that, but I am not being serious.I think that almost everything the devs do is to make the game better, and not just to make more money. But I do think that all the stuff with Pro Battle Passes recently is to try to earn more money. Tanki online gets a lot of negative feedback from their updates. But part of that is because people are much more likely to complain, than to compliment. Some people are angry that tanki online doesn't heed player feedback often. But, lets face it. Its their game, and their company. They can do whatever they want in it. So stop complaining! Give them useful feedback that they will actually find helpful.
